When you hear her story it sounds like a nightmare. At age 17, Sabrina
Butler had a nine-month old son with a heart murmur who stopped
breathing in his crib. After a frantic half hour the baby arrived in
the emergency room but doctors were unable to revive him.
The
next day Butler was arrested for child abuse due to the bruises left by
resuscitation attempts and in March 1990 was wrongfully convicted of
capital murder and sentenced to death row.
